General Directions for A Comfortable Walking with God
While Robert Bolton originally wrote General Directions as a spiritual guide
for himself, its publication led to its becoming an instant classic. This book
encourages us to abandon our loved sin, hate hypocrisy, exercise self-denial,
live the life of faith, form right conceptions of Christianity, guard against
worldliness, be warmed with the love of God, treasure reconciliation with God,
keep the heart, and meditate on future bliss in order to loosen sin's grip on
the soul. Bolton also excels in describing particular Christian duties, such as
tending to family, governing the tongue, and managing every action of our
lives. Read Bolton's book, be encouraged in your Christian walk, and find out
first hand why generations of believers have cherished this sound volume of
pastoral advice.
Robert Bolton (1572-1631) was an Oxford graduate, university lecturer, and
became a minister of the gospel in Broughton, Northamptonshire.
